The Kobo (Borders) eReader is a low cost 6-Inch E-Ink based electronic book reader that arguably sparked the eBook price war between Amazon and Barnes & Noble this year. Kobo, originally a spin off of Toronto-based Indigo Books & Music, partnered with Borders to deliver a new eBook solution to the marketplace...
